Inp.polri.go.id - Malang. President Prabowo Subianto has announced plans to establish SMA Garuda high schools, a new network of senior high schools designed to complement the existing SMA Taruna Nusantara high school system and expand access to high-quality education across Indonesia.
Speaking during the inauguration of SMA Taruna Nusantara High School’s Malang campus in East Java on Tuesday (13/1/2026), he said the government is targeting the creation of 20 SMA Garuda schools nationwide.
“We will establish around 20 additional schools under the name SMA Garuda,” the President said, as quoted by antaranews.com
He explained that SMA Garuda will adopt a similar philosophy to SMA Taruna Nusantara by selecting top students and providing intensive education focused on science, technology, leadership, and character building.
The initiative follows up President Prabowo’s vision of having at least one high quality public school in every province as part of a broader national strategy to strengthen human capital and long-term competitiveness.
